REACTIVE ACTIONS

Fri 26 Jan 2018, 16:07

As you can only Parry or Dodge if you have an action left that would mean that it’s not so good to be very quick because you can’t parry anymore. Or will this reduce your actions for the next round if you haven’t any actions left? Or could you reserve on action so that you can take a Reactive Action?

Re: REACTIVE ACTIONS

Fri 26 Jan 2018, 16:39

The idea is that you save one of your action. If you are using the advanced combat rules, it is called Await. The saved action can be used for a parry or a dodge later in the combat turn.
